      @@ChristineSolazzo Building desire to play is not what this video is about. You can build desire if you end the play when he still wants to play. Waiting until the dog is tired or loses interest kills desire. There is a quick example of getting the dog to become active and play is in the video. If the dog crashes in 1 minute then end play at 30 seconds... every day you play to add a few more seconds. Subscribe and maybe we can get a video on what you are looking for created in the future.
